Sharjah's 9 new buses comply with Euro 5 standards

The Sharjah Roads and Transport Authority (SRTA) announced the launch of nine new buses that comply with Euro 5 exhaust emissions standards.

This new fleet joins the emirate's public transport network, bringing the total number of buses in operation to 138.
This step comes as part of the authority's ongoing efforts to modernise the public transport system and enhance the level of services provided to residents and visitors, in accordance with the highest approved operational and environmental standards.
Engineer Yousef Khamis Al Othmani, Chairman of SRTA, emphasised that the launch of the new buses reflects the Authority's commitment to expanding and developing its public transport fleet, keeping pace with the emirate's growing population and the growing demand for public transport services.
